> I'm facing with a problem using a web service (that is a deployed Bpel 
> process).
> 
> The expected input for my web service is the following:
> <input>
>  <part xmlns:xsi="http://www.w3.org/..."; name="payload">
>   <AppMailVerifier2Request xmlns="http://acm.org/samples";>
>    <input>my_data</input>
>   </AppMailVerifier2Request>
>  </part>
> </input>
> 
> But when my program runs (it's an open source using Axis classes), I realize 
> that the following message is sent instead of the former:
> 
> <input>
>  <part xmlns:xsi="..." name="payload">
>   <operationName>
>    <AppMailVerifier2Request xmlns="...">
>     <input>my_data</input>
>    </AppMailVerifier2Request>
>   </operationName>
>  </part>
> </input>
> 
> As you can see, in the message sent to the web service (the latter), the tag 
> <operationName> is (incorrectly) added to the message.
> Note that operationName is the name of WSDL operation that I invoke with a 
> call object.
> 
> How can I solve this problem (i.e. removing the <operationName> tag from the 
> message sent to the web service)?
